Nonideal Electromotive Force of Zirconia Sensors for Unsaturated Hydrocarbon Gases

Abstract
Non‐Nernstian behaviors of a zirconia‐based oxygen sensor for saturated and unsaturated hydrocarbon gases were studied in the presence of 10% oxygen at . The sensor, using an sensing electrode, produced large electromotive forces (emfs) for the unsaturated hydrocarbons which were aliphatic as well as aromatic. The emf values of the sensor for the hydrocarbons were strongly affected by their unsaturation fraction, carbon number, and chain structure. ©1998 The Electrochemical Society
